Michael Lesnick is a scholar working on Computational Theory and Mathematics, Mathematical Physics and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, Michael Lesnick has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 258 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Computational Theory and Mathematics, 7 papers in Mathematical Physics and 3 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in Michael Lesnick’s work include Topological and Geometric Data Analysis (11 papers), Homotopy and Cohomology in Algebraic Topology (6 papers) and Advanced Neuroimaging Techniques and Applications (3 papers). Michael Lesnick is often cited by papers focused on Topological and Geometric Data Analysis (11 papers), Homotopy and Cohomology in Algebraic Topology (6 papers) and Advanced Neuroimaging Techniques and Applications (3 papers). Michael Lesnick collaborates with scholars based in United States, Austria and Sweden. Michael Lesnick's co-authors include Michael Kerber, Raúl Rabadán, Leonidas Guibas, Jian Sun and Vijay S. Pande and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Chemical Physics, Transactions of the American Mathematical Society and Discrete & Computational Geometry.
